Transaction 30a66451c7248104156d6d68b2edabf2d442a7536be30576a49a0e9de73a2281
1 Input
1 Output
-
30a66451c7248104156d6d68b2edabf2d442a7536be30576a49a0e9de73a2281:0
- value
- 204853312
- script pubkey
- OP_0 OP_PUSHBYTES_20 1a2aef48eb62506b581b538b9590c4c60ffb9c0e
- address
- bc1qrg4w7j8tvfgxkkqm2w9etyxycc8lh8qwf89fx3